Como protege uma html do ctrl + u

Ver o tópico anterior Ver o tópico seguinte Ir em baixo

Resolvido Como protege uma html do ctrl + u

Mensagem por Hyouki em 30/11/12, 06:21 pm

Qual é minha questão:
Olá amigos , estou com uma duvida há como previnir que outras pessoas usem o " ctrl + u  " para pegar o código de uma pagina html qualquer de meu fórum ? ou de outra forma há como proteger deles pegarem o conteúdo da html ? .

Endereço do meu fórum:
http://www.forum-dix.com.br

Versão do fórum:
PHPBB3


Última edição por lucasxd111 em 30/11/12, 08:01 pm, editado 1 vez(es)
avatar

Hyouki
Membro do Fórum

Masculino
Inscrito dia : 10/02/2012
Mensagens : 1490
Pontos Ativos : 1972

Ver perfil do usuário http://www.forum-dix.wikiforum.net

Resolvido Re: Como protege uma html do ctrl + u

Mensagem por BrunoH. em 30/11/12, 06:23 pm

Olá!
Coloque este código em seu HTML:
Código:
<script language=’JavaScript’>
function checartecla (evt)
{if (evt.keyCode == '17')
{alert(&quot;Comando Desativado&quot;)
return false}
return true}
</script>

Até mais! Piscada

Tópico movido de 'Questões sobre a aparência do fórum' para 'Questões sobre códigos'
avatar

BrunoH.
Principal contribuidor
Principal contribuidor

Inscrito dia : 15/06/2012
Mensagens : 7675
Pontos Ativos : 10382

Ver perfil do usuário http://premiumdesign3d.blogspot.com.br/ https://www.facebook.com/brunohenrique.com.br

Resolvido Re: Como protege uma html do ctrl + u

Mensagem por Consolado em 30/11/12, 06:46 pm

Olá!

Não há como bloquear o uso deste botão. De qualquer forma, o "view-source" mostrará o código-fonte da página. Adicione este código no início da tag "<body>" da sua página HTML:
Código:
<script language=JavaScript> <!-- var message=""; /////////////////////////////////// function clickIE4(){ if (event.button==2){ alert(message); return false; } } function clickNS4(e){ if (document.layers||document.getElementById&&!document.all){ if (e.which==2||e.which==3){ alert(message); return false; } } } if (document.layers){ document.captureEvents(Event.MOUSEDOWN); document.onmousedown=clickNS4; } else if (document.all&&!document.getElementById){ document.onmousedown=clickIE4; } document.oncontextmenu=new Function("alert(message);return false") // --> </script> </html> <body onkeydown="return false"> <body oncontextmenu="return false" ondragstart="return false" onselectstart="return false" onload="zzcatfishclose();">
Ela irá impedir o uso do CTRL+U e bloqueia o uso do botão direito do mouse.

Melhores cumprimentos.
avatar

Consolado
Super usuário

Inscrito dia : 09/05/2011
Mensagens : 4243
Pontos Ativos : 6128

Ver perfil do usuário

Resolvido Re: Como protege uma html do ctrl + u

Mensagem por Hyouki em 30/11/12, 08:01 pm

Olá amigo , obrigado a todos que cooperaram na ajuda . Piscada
resolvido
avatar

Hyouki
Membro do Fórum

Masculino
Inscrito dia : 10/02/2012
Mensagens : 1490
Pontos Ativos : 1972

Ver perfil do usuário http://www.forum-dix.wikiforum.net

Ver o tópico anterior Ver o tópico seguinte Voltar ao Topo

- Tópicos similares

Permissão deste fórum:
Você não pode responder aos tópicos neste fórum